Baja Sardinia Weather in January
With daytime temperatures of 14°C (57°F) and nighttime lows of 9°C (48°F), January in Baja Sardinia brings moderate temperatures during the day. Some rainfall is to be expected during the month.
Rainfall in Baja Sardinia in January
Rain is expected on roughly 15 days, totalling around 56 mm (2.2 in) for the month. Rain is frequent but mostly light this month, with brief showers more common than heavy downpours.
Temperature in Baja Sardinia in January
If you're visiting Baja Sardinia in January, expect highs of 14°C (57°F) and overnight lows around 9°C (48°F). January is typically considered a winter month. A light jacket or extra layer can be useful, especially outside the warmest hours of the day. Nights fall to 9°C (48°F), which is cold enough to feel it indoors too. Sunshine in Baja Sardinia in January
The month experiences a moderate amount of sunlight, with 125 hours of sunshine. This provides a nice balance between sunshine and clouds.January in Baja Sardinia has its charm. What to Wear in Baja Sardinia in January
Pack for changing conditions in Baja Sardinia in January. Bring a mix of short and long sleeves, a warm layer like a hoodie or light jacket, and comfortable pants. The key is being able to add or remove layers as the days goes by. Rain gear is recommended, you can expect wet weather on multiple days.
